Recaptcha enterprise angular In the reCAPTCHA keys list, hold the pointer over the key you want to copy, and then click content_copy . render() to render it programmatically. 1 - jsDocs. To start with, you need to import the RecaptchaV3Module and provide your reCAPTCHA v3 site key using RECAPTCHA_V3_SITE_KEY injection token: May 16, 2023 · There are three versions of Google reCAPTCHA: reCAPTCHA Enterprise, reCAPTCHA V2 and reCAPTCHA V3. 0' in dependencies section of your app-level build. Use the below command to create your Angular application. For web users, you can get the user’s response token in one of three ways: g-recaptcha-response POST parameter when the user submits the form on your site; grecaptcha. Big thanks to @medbenmakhlouf for their contribution! BREAKING CHANGES. To copy the ID of an existing key using the gcloud CLI, use the gcloud recaptcha keys list command. reCAPTCHA website security and fraud protection | Google Cloud Application example built with Angular 15 and adding the Google reCAPTCHA v2 using the ng-recaptcha library. Schedule you won website for reCaptcha sign in with your Google account. x to retain support for a previous Angular version May 7, 2025 · If you are new to reCAPTCHA, then do the following: Configure reCAPTCHA on your Google Cloud project. js, ng-recaptcha, @angular/core, @angular/forms, @angular/common, @angular/router, @angular/compiler, @angular/animations, @angular/platform-browser and @angular/platform-browser-dynamic. To work with v3 APIs, ng-recaptcha provides a service (as opposed to a component). There are 35 other projects in the npm registry using ngx-captcha. 0, last published: 10 hours ago. There are 277 other projects in the npm registry using ng-recaptcha. You can use reCAPTCHA Enterprise Fraud Prevention to protect payment transactions against attacks such as carding, stolen instrument fraud, and account takeover payment fraud. Along the way, we will use features like custom Oct 8, 2021 · Download the code: https://gitlab. As reCAPTCHA v3 doesn't ever interrupt the user flow, you can first run reCAPTCHA without taking action and then decide on thresholds by looking at your traffic in the admin console. Net Core ASP. Start using ng-recaptcha in your project by running `npm i ng-recaptcha`. Pin ng-recaptcha to v12. 2 Server side implementation. Oct 13, 2021 · I have a Login page in Angular who shows a reCaptcha challenge to be completed only when the userName has been attepting to logIn with an invalid password several times in a short time lapse. explicit: Optional. keys. gle/3DjumEBreCAPTCHA Enterprise learns by monitoring real traffic on your website, assigning a score to each request based Jul 10, 2024 · Choosing the type of reCAPTCHA There are four types of reCAPTCHA to choose from when creating a new site. To Implement reCAPTCHA v3 functionality first we have to create the google reCAPTCHA account. 1'. In your Angular app, open the angular. 0, last published: 2 years ago. enterprise. The reCAPTCHA Enterprise provider will not require users to solve a challenge at any time. The docs say you need to do this Add the following initialization code to your application, before you access any Firebase services firebase. reCAPTCHA offers enhanced detection with more granular scores, reason codes for risky events, mobile app SDKs, password <re-captcha> supports various languages. This method receives an optional argument widgetId, useful for getting the response of a specific reCaptcha widget (in case you render more than one widget). Learn how to structure large Angular applications and implement them in a monorepo and/or as Micro Frontends. 9; Connect with us; You should use reCAPTCHA Enterprise for new integrations 6 days ago · reCAPTCHA keys represent how reCAPTCHA is configured for a website. Jul 30, 2010 · If you have multiple recaptcha widgets on the same page then the reset() method will default to the first, unless the widgetId is specified. Other features such as real time analytics provide the best place to start for most developers. Check the user response with Google. The ReCAPTCHA uses a checkbox. Ensure that your environment supports tokens larger than 8 kB because reCAPTCHA Fraud Prevention might use larger tokens. js; Migrate from Genkit 0. Can I use reCAPTCHA with third party solutions? Yes, you can use both reCAPTCHA (non-Enterprise version) and reCAPTCHA May 8, 2025 · Note that App Check uses reCAPTCHA Enterprise score-based site keys, which make it invisible to users. May 8, 2025 · Using Genkit with Angular; Using Genkit with Next. Angular component for Google reCAPTCHA. This happens because the last version firebase auth, uses recaptcha:18. For this reason, scores in a staging environment or soon after implementing may differ from production. gcloud Mar 25, 2024 · In the current digital age, online security is more important than ever. A project based on rxjs, tslib, core-js, zone. Before you begin. Dec 13, 2017 · Schedule your won website to account on Google reCaptcha utility . 1, last published: a year ago. Ensure that you have the following Identity and Access Management role: reCAPTCHA Enterprise Admin (roles/recaptchaenterprise. data-sitekey="6LeCCoYfAAA" data-callback='becomePartner' data-action='submit'>Submit</button> See full list on dev. May 7, 2025 · With reCAPTCHA, you can protect your websites or mobile applications from spam and abuse, and detect other types of fraudulent activities, such as credential stuffing, account takeover (ATO), and automated account creation. Para conocer las diferencias entre reCAPTCHA v3 y reCAPTCHA Enterprise, consulta la comparación de funciones. NET Monsters there is an example, but targeting reCAPTCHA V3 and not reCAPTCHA enterprise. Angular has fantastic built in forms functionality which makes it easy to write powerful custom components and validation logic. io Jun 9, 2021 · You could also achieve this with a service and interceptor (code below). js TypeScript Angular component for Google reCAPTCHA. How does reCAPTCHA work? ReCaptcha components for Angular. reCAPTCHA Enterprise builds on this t Ouvrez la section reCAPTCHA Enterprise de la console Cloud, puis procédez comme suit: Si vous êtes invité à activer l'API reCAPTCHA Enterprise, faites-le. There is also a nice post here Google ReCaptcha v3 server-side validation using ASP. Go to reCAPTCHA Enterprise API. 2. 1. Gradle dependency we are using is 'com. The API doesn't offer a simple or reliable way to find the widget Id in code. reCAPTCHA v3 It is a pure JavaScript API returning a score, giving you the ability to take action in the context of your site: for instance requiring additional factors of authentication, sending a post to moderation, or throttling bots Or you can programmatically get the response that you need to send to your server, use the method getResponse() from the vcRecaptchaService angular service. You need to call grecaptcha. to reCAPTCHA v3 introduces a different way of bot protection. js. There are 278 other projects in the npm registry using ng-recaptcha. This page contains code samples for reCAPTCHA. if the reCAPTCHA's score is near 1. There are reports from our users that they are not able Jun 5, 2017 · In this article, we are going to implement from scratch a reCAPTCHA directive for Angular applications including the server side with express js. May 7, 2025 · Go to the reCAPTCHA page. package: - Angular v16 is no longer supported with this version. In this tutorial, we will learn one of the important concepts that are what Recaptcha is and how we can implement the Google Recaptcha Integration in Angular application. reCAPTCHA Enterprise API client for Node. May 8, 2025 · If loading reCAPTCHA asynchronously is not an option, including preconnect resource hints for reCAPTCHA is strongly recommended. Setting up reCAPTCHA on a website involves the following steps: Create a reCAPTCHA key for your website (also known as key). Dec 25, 2019 · I'd like to protect a register page from automatic submitions, so I decided to try reCaptcha v3. com/ryanlogsdon/captchareCAPTCHA setup: https://www. It uses advanced risk analysis techniques to tell humans and bots apart. May 7, 2025 · Optional, default value. Google reCAPTCHA Account Setup May 7, 2025 · When this button is used to submit a form on your site, the g-recaptcha-response POST parameter contains the response token. The configuration includes important options such as whether to show CAPTCHA challenges. Recomendamos que los desarrolladores de apps que usan reCAPTCHA v3 realicen la actualización cuando sea posible. Google reCAPTCHA v3 emerges as a powerful solution, offering a solid defense without disrupting user interaction. android. Set up your Firebase project Sep 18, 2024 · This document provides an overview of Google reCAPTCHA v3 and v2. Create a score-based reCAPTCHA key. 0 , but again on reCAPTCHA V3. Note: If you set the g-recaptcha button as disabled, the button is enabled when reCAPTCHA is loaded. Note: For use with checkbox site keys. This tutorial was posted on my blog in portuguese and on the DEV Community in english. Jan 30, 2014 · When working with angularjs and google recaptcha, the library you have used is the best option. Get started here. Install it using the following command: npm install ng-recaptcha Subsection 1. 1. Dynamic captcha (Google reCaptcha) implementation for Angular. Click Enable. Verify that the name of your project appears in the project selector at the top of the page. siteKey reCAPTCHA v3 depends on the scoring points between 0. gradle file. By Oct 14, 2024 · This page explains how to verify a user's response to a reCAPTCHA challenge from your application's backend. Sep 10, 2021 · 5. Dec 11, 2023 · To streamline the integration process for reCAPTCHA v2, utilize the ng-recaptcha library. package: add Angular 17 support , closes #310. Import the FormsModule, RecaptchaFormsModule, RecaptchaModule modules. So, let’s start with creating the reCAPTCHA account. 0. reCAPTCHA is a free service that protects your site from spam and abuse. json file and add the reCAPTCHA script to the scripts array: Jan 20, 2017 · Update: If your question is how to set reCAPTCHA on the Google site for using it in localhost, then it has be as I wrote it above, but if you are curious how you can use reCAPTCHA on both localhost and a website host by minimal code in your controller and prevent some codes like ConfigurationManager. Enable reCAPTCHA Fraud Prevention. x. Net WebApi Angular Entity Framework Sql Server Amazon Web Services. What do I get? Extended 6th edition with 20 chapters Source code examples PDF and epub (Android and iOS) What do I learn? ☑️ Structuring large Angular applications ☑️ Ensuring long-term maintainability Oct 1, 2024 · Implement Google reCaptcha in Angular🚀 Boost your Angular app's security by adding Google reCAPTCHA! google recaptcha,recaptcha,google recaptcha v2,recaptch Google's reCAPTCHA is an awesome, UX-friendly way of ensuring that the users who are submitting your forms are actually humans. Debes usar reCAPTCHA Enterprise para las integraciones nuevas. 3: Configuring reCAPTCHA v2 in Angular. The enterprise version allows unlimited daily and monthly captcha requests to your web site and is priced as a subscription with an initial trial available. Latest version: 13. To search and filter code samples for other Google Cloud products, see the Google Cloud sample browser . By default recaptcha will guess the user's language itself (which is beyond the scope of this lib). If you want to use App Check with your own custom provider, see Implement a custom App Check provider. I'm using a static Blazor SSR project with Google ReCAPTCHA Enterprise. Start using ngx-captcha in your project by running `npm i ngx-captcha`. Does not render the widget automatically. By the end of this tutorial you will be able to know: Jul 23, 2024 · By integrating reCAPTCHA, websites can reduce fraud, protect user data, and maintain the integrity of their services. Jun 9, 2021 · Hi I am trying to use firebase app check with my angular project. ng new angular-recaptcha. Renders the widget in the first g-recaptcha tag it finds. How to implement Google reCAPTCHA in Angular, Google reCAPTCHA with Angular forms, Create a Google reCAPTCHA Account (API Key), Add the reCAPTCHA widget to your form, Home C# ASP. admin). Choose the key type that is best for your use case. 0 or implementation 'com. Application example built with Angular 18 and adding the Google reCAPTCHA v3 using the ng-recaptcha library. Let's create the application with the Angular base structure using the @angular/cli with the route Jul 10, 2024 · reCAPTCHA Enterprise offers up to 10,000 assessments per month at no cost and also provides additional features. This will minimize the amount of time that the script download blocks the parser. For more information, see Protect payment transactions with Fraud Prevention. Apr 21, 2022 · I'm trying to implement recaptcha enterprise in angular 12, but documentation is not being clear, I implemented it in the class according to the documentation link, but the method does not return the token in $event. Créez une clé de type Site Web. list method. But you can override this behavior and provide a specific language to use by setting the "hl" search param in the onBeforeLoad hook. Change the app. google. 0 means more trusted users and fewer chances of spam. AppSettings["ReCaptcha:SiteKey"] in it, then I help you with this extra description and code in Jul 10, 2024 · reCAPTCHA learns by seeing real traffic on your site. This tool will help you create a new reCAPTCHA Site Key, and if needed also create a new Google Cloud account. 4. The implementation would be to add the following script to a page like the following example: @ Jan 29, 2025 · reCAPTCHA Enterprise Fraud Prevention is generally available. Latest version: 6. module. Contribute to DethAriel/ng-recaptcha development by creating an account on GitHub. Mar 31, 2021 · In ASP. Live preview:. If you don't see the name of your project, click the project selector, and then select your project. For information about reCAPTCHA Enterprise, see the reCAPTCHA Enterprise documentation. Jan 11, 2024 · As answered by Martin Reindl, you can override reCaptcha version by adding recaptcha_enterprise_flutter: ^18. 0 and 1. Websites and applications must protect themselves from automated attacks and malicious behavior, while maintaining a smooth and welcoming user experience. com/recaptcha/admin/createreCAPTCHA admin dashboard: https://www reCAPTCHA has over a decade of experience defending the internet and data for its network of more than 5 million sites. But you have to take care of the following things for it to work. Ten en cuenta que reCAPTCHA v3 es invisible para los usuarios. We have integrated reCaptcha enterprise in our android app. It's an Angular application, and I'm using ng-recaptcha module for easier integration. Start using @google-cloud/recaptcha-enterprise in your project by running `npm i @google-cloud/recaptcha-enterprise`. Configure the Google reCAPTCHA key. To get started with reCAPTCHA Enterprise, you can use our Site Registration Tool. May 7, 2025 · In the Google Cloud console, go to the reCAPTCHA Enterprise API page. Contribute to Enngage/ngx-captcha development by creating an account on GitHub. getResponse(opt_widget_id) after the user completes the reCAPTCHA Documentation for npm package ng-recaptcha@13. May 7, 2025 · This document provides a high-level overview of setting up reCAPTCHA on websites. Google reCAPTCHA Enterprise offers enhanced detection compared to earlier versions, with more granular scores, reason codes for risky events, mobile app SDKs, password breach and leak detection, multi-factor authentication (MFA), and the ability to tune your site-specific model to protect enterprise businesses. Vous devrez spécifier les domaines sur lesquels vous hébergez votre application Web. Then create a component. Java Python Ruby PHP Node. NET Core 5. initializeApp({ // Your fireba Jul 23, 2024 · In this blog, we can see a demo of integrating reCaptcha in our Angular Application. Prepare your environment for reCAPTCHA. ts file and add the lines as below. In the Google Cloud console, go to the reCAPTCHA page. To copy the ID of an existing key using the REST API, use the projects. For Angular developers looking to implement this Oct 8, 2024 · The easiest method for rendering the reCAPTCHA widget on your page is to include the necessary JavaScript resource and a g-recaptcha tag. After the token is generated, send the reCAPTCHA token to your backend and create an assessment within two minutes. Go to reCAPTCHA. Let's create the application with the Angular base structure using the @angular/cli with the route Dec 31, 2019 · Angular is powerful and modern framework for secured and standard that provides almost every basic developers needs in one package, from form validators, Rxjs library, PWA integration and lots more. Laissez l'option "Utiliser la case à cocher" désélectionnée. The key is required to collect information about the user actions and send it to reCAPTCHA. The service should probably add some kind of caching of tokens (shorter TTLs for more security, longer TTLs for lower costs). The g-recaptcha tag is a DIV element with class name g-recaptcha and your site key in the data-sitekey attribute: reCAPTCHA website security and fraud protection | Google Cloud reCAPTCHA Enterprise → https://goo. recaptcha:recaptcha:18. 5 to 0. gkju gxsz vwcbhybw fws neclnl rmuh mirn sxogun fcr make ymmvrixx kzwqw lmotvc xqatlry xzxmbts